Output 791e5408b4c949c38d1ed1b9bdbabaeb37d17b0357523adf57f3788061a80069:0

value
232708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b95f83794c5d95f14aba8b7ce2ffbb5585e4471 OP_EQUAL
address
3BVst955hhuotf4FQULx9g16GEYFkiGVLm
transaction
791e5408b4c949c38d1ed1b9bdbabaeb37d17b0357523adf57f3788061a80069
confirmations
170351
spent
true